- [ ] **Step 7: Breaker override escrow.** After sealing the signing keys for the Tallgrove upstream API circuit breaker, confirm the support team can force the breaker open during a full outage. The override bundle lives in the sealed escrow drawer and is useless without its unlock phrase. Two ceremony witnesses must initial this step before proceeding. The escrow bundle is decrypted with the recovery passphrase that follows.

vault phrase of kahip-kahop = holath-quenmir

As part of your onboarding with the Hazelport team, you've requested the internal `logtrawl` CLI, which tails production logs from the Cinderfield streaming cluster. Note that logtrawl can surface unredacted request payloads, so access is gated: complete the data-handling briefing, confirm you've read the retention policy page, and attach your completed checklist to this ticket. Contractor grants are time-boxed to 90 days. The sign-off must come from the tool's accountable owner, named below.

named custodian: Brivan Eliath Quenox Frador

## Flaky DNS Resolution

Intermittent NXDOMAIN responses on the Harrowgate cluster usually indicate a stale resolver cache on node group C. First, confirm the failure with three consecutive lookups spaced ten seconds apart. Then flush the cache via the Pinefold admin endpoint, which requires authenticated access. Authenticate your request using the key that follows.

API key for yahig-tadup: kto7_ubizbYm

The brisk CLI handles batch image resizing against the Fernvale render farm. Invoke brisk resize with a manifest file; jobs over 500 images are queued and processed in parallel shards. As a contractor, use the sandbox profile only. Authenticate the CLI against the internal render gateway with the key below.

gateway credential: kto23_LX9A4ys6i4nzHtpOLNLodKK

Minutes — Veltrane Industries Management Meeting. Warranty costs on the Korvex pump line exceeded forecast by 18%, driven by seal failures from the Dunmarsh plant. Remediation plan approved; supplier audit begins next month. R. Hastwell to report monthly to the board. Reserves adjusted accordingly. The confidential outlook on related business plans follows below.

internal memo for yahag-tahog: The pricing group signed off on a budget of $152.8 million for Project Soriel.